【shadowshock怎么搭建ip】在使用 Shadowsocks(通常被简称为“Shadowsocks”)进行网络代理时,很多人会遇到“如何搭建IP”的问题。虽然 Shadowsocks 本身并不直接提供“搭建IP”的功能,但用户可以通过配置服务器、设置端口和加密方式来实现类似“IP绑定”或“IP映射”的效果。以下是对这一过程的总结。
一、
Shadowsocks 是一款基于 socks5 协议的代理工具,主要用于绕过网络限制。要实现类似“搭建IP”的功能,通常是指将 Shadowsocks 配置为通过特定 IP 地址进行连接。这需要在服务器端进行配置,并确保客户端正确指向该 IP 和端口。
搭建 Shadowsocks 的核心步骤包括:
1. 选择合适的服务器:可以是 VPS 或云服务器。
2. 安装 Shadowsocks 服务端:根据服务器系统(如 Ubuntu、CentOS)进行安装。
3. 配置 Shadowsocks 的配置文件:设置监听 IP、端口、密码、加密方式等。
4. 开放防火墙与端口:确保客户端可以访问指定的 IP 和端口。
5. 客户端连接配置:输入服务器 IP、端口、密码、加密方式等信息。
此外,若想实现“IP绑定”,可能还需要结合 Nginx、反向代理或其他网络工具进行配置。
二、表格展示关键步骤
步骤 | 操作内容 | 说明 |
1 | 选择服务器 | 推荐使用 VPS 或云服务器,如 DigitalOcean、Linode 等 |
2 | 安装 Shadowsocks | 使用命令行安装,如 `pip install shadowsocks` 或通过脚本一键安装 |
3 | 编辑配置文件 | 修改 `config.json` 文件,设置 `server` 为服务器 IP,`server_port` 为端口号 |
4 | 设置加密方式 | 如 `aes-256-cfb`、`chacha20` 等,提高安全性 |
5 | 开放防火墙 | 允许入站流量通过指定端口(如 8388) |
6 | 启动 Shadowsocks 服务 | 使用 `ssserver -c config.json` 命令启动服务 |
7 | 配置客户端 | 在 Shadowsocks 客户端中填写服务器 IP、端口、密码、加密方式 |
8 | 测试连接 | 确保客户端能正常连接并访问外网 |
三、注意事项
- IP 地址选择:建议使用公网 IP,避免使用内网 IP。
- 安全设置:不要使用默认端口,建议自定义端口并设置强密码。
- 定期更新:保持 Shadowsocks 版本更新,防止漏洞。
- 法律合规:使用代理工具需遵守当地法律法规,合法使用网络资源。
如需更高级的“IP绑定”或“IP伪装”功能,可结合 Nginx、OpenVPN 或其他工具实现。整体而言,Shadowsocks 的搭建过程相对简单,但对网络知识有一定要求,建议初学者参考官方文档或社区教程逐步操作。